Flowers of Bhutan — 1326 plant species documented across the Bhutanese Himalaya, from dense broadleaf and conifer forests to alpine scrub and meadows. Bhutan’s largely intact wilderness shelters an exceptional diversity of orchids, rhododendrons, primulas and Himalayan poppies, many of them regional endemics. Each species page includes a botanical description, distribution, habitat and flowering time, with the original photograph and its recorded altitude and locality.

Crotalaria albida is one of the most widespread Asian rattlepods, ranging from Pakistan, India, Nepal, Bhutan and Bangladesh eastward through China, Taiwan, Hong Kong, Myanmar, Thailand, Laos, Vietnam and Malesia to the Philippines, Indonesia, New Guinea and Australia, with naturalised records in Sri Lanka and the United States; over 2100 GBIF occurrences attest to this amplitude. In the Himalaya it favours open grassy hillsides, dry banks, pine-forest margins and disturbed roadsides on well-drained, often acidic soils. The plant photographed near Melamchi Pul in the Helambu region of central Nepal, at about 1080 m in May, typifies its preference for warm, low to mid-montane slopes between roughly 300 and 2300 m.

It is a slender, erect to ascending perennial herb or subshrub 30-90 cm tall, the wiry stems clothed in appressed silvery hairs. The leaves are simple, unifoliolate, oblong to oblanceolate and shortly petiolate, paler and pubescent beneath. The inflorescence is a slender terminal raceme of small papilionaceous flowers; the standard is pale yellow, often veined reddish-brown, and the keel is incurved and beaked. The calyx is bilabiate and hairy. As in the genus, the fruit is a short, inflated, glabrescent legume in which the loosened seeds rattle when dry.

The epithet albida alludes to the whitish, silky indumentum. Crotalaria is a large pantropical genus, and many species, including this one, contain pyrrolizidine alkaloids that render them toxic to livestock, though the plant is used locally in folk medicine. Its nitrogen-fixing root nodules enrich degraded slopes, and the species behaves as a pioneer colonist of disturbed ground, accounting for its extensive distribution and naturalisation.

Crotalaria bhutanica is a narrowly distributed legume of the eastern Himalaya, described from and centred on Bhutan; it has no georeferenced records in GBIF, underscoring how poorly documented and locally restricted this taxon remains. It is a plant of open grassy slopes, scrub and disturbed montane ground, and the two collection sites given, the Haar valley at about 3300 m and Dochu-La at 2700 m, both in September, place it in the cool temperate to subalpine zone of western and central Bhutan, where it flowers and fruits in the late monsoon and early autumn.

Like others of its genus, the species is a herb or small subshrub with simple or trifoliolate leaves and stems bearing the appressed hairs characteristic of Crotalaria. The flowers are arranged in terminal or leaf-opposed racemes and have the typical papilionaceous structure of the genus, with a large rounded standard, two lateral wings and a beaked keel enclosing the stamens and style; the corolla is yellow, sometimes veined or flushed with brown or purple. The fruit, as in all Crotalaria, is an inflated, bladder-like pod in which the loosened seeds rattle when ripe, the feature that gives the genus its name (from the Greek krotalon, a rattle).

Crotalaria (tribe Crotalarieae, subfamily Faboideae) is a large pantropical genus, and C. bhutanica is one of its restricted Himalayan endemics, distinguished within the regional flora by its combination of habit, indumentum and floral detail. Like most papilionoid legumes it forms nitrogen-fixing root nodules with rhizobia and is pollinated by bees adapted to tripping the keel mechanism. Given its apparently very limited range, the absence of occurrence data, and ongoing pressures on Himalayan grassland habitats, the species warrants targeted survey and a formal conservation assessment.

Crotalaria cytisoides is a shrubby rattlepod of the Himalaya and into Southeast Asia. GBIF records it from China, India, Nepal, Myanmar, Thailand, Bhutan, Laos, Malaysia and Indonesia, with further occurrences extending to Madagascar and Uganda, totalling over 400 records. It grows on open hill slopes, scrub, grassy banks, forest margins and roadsides at lower to middle elevations, broadly between 1000 and 2700 m. The plant shown was photographed near Trongsa in central Bhutan at 2100 m in October, flowering in the post-monsoon period along the warm temperate hill zone where this species is a frequent component of disturbed scrub.

It is a much-branched shrub or undershrub with silky-pubescent young branches. The leaves are trifoliolate, the obovate to elliptic leaflets softly hairy beneath, subtended by small stipules. The flowers are borne in terminal and leaf-opposed racemes; the papilionaceous corolla is yellow, sometimes veined or flushed reddish-brown on the standard, with the keel beaked as is typical of the genus. The fruit is an inflated, oblong legume in which the loosened ripe seeds rattle when shaken, the feature giving Crotalaria its English name rattlepod.

Crotalaria is a large pantropical legume genus, and like its relatives it forms root nodules with nitrogen-fixing rhizobia, enriching poor soils and contributing to its success as a coloniser of disturbed ground. Many species, including this one, contain pyrrolizidine alkaloids that deter herbivores and can be toxic to livestock. With its wide distribution, ruderal tendency and abundant seed production, C. cytisoides is common and of no conservation concern across its broad range.

Crotalaria sessiliflora is a wide-ranging Asian-Australasian rattlepod, recorded by GBIF (3102 occurrences) from China, Japan, Korea, Taiwan, India, Thailand, Indonesia, Papua New Guinea, Australia, Nepal, the Philippines, Myanmar, Bhutan, Malaysia and Indochina. It is a plant of open, sunny, seasonally dry habitats, occupying grasslands, hill slopes, fallow fields, roadsides and waste ground from the lowlands up into the lower mountains, roughly to 2800 m. The photographed plant from near Wangdi in western Bhutan at about 2800 m, flowering in September, sits at the upper elevational margin of the species and reflects its late-monsoon flowering across the eastern Himalaya.

The species is an erect annual herb, usually 30-100 cm tall, with stems and foliage clothed in long, spreading brownish hairs. The leaves are simple (unifoliolate), narrowly linear to oblanceolate, sessile or shortly petiolate, with conspicuous setose stipules. The flowers are borne in dense, head-like or short terminal racemes, often crowded and almost sessile as the epithet indicates, each subtended by leafy bracts. The papilionate corolla is blue, violet or pale purple, the standard hairy outside. As in Crotalaria the stamens are monadelphous with dimorphic anthers. The fruit is a small, inflated, oblong pod enclosed by the persistent calyx, the loose seeds rattling within when ripe.

Described by Linnaeus, the species belongs to the large pantropical genus Crotalaria (Fabaceae, subfamily Faboideae, tribe Crotalarieae). Like its relatives it forms root nodules with rhizobial bacteria, fixing atmospheric nitrogen and enriching soils, and is sometimes grown as a green manure. The plant contains pyrrolizidine alkaloids and is used in traditional Asian medicine, though these compounds render it potentially toxic to livestock. With an extensive range and weedy tendencies it is of least conservation concern.

Crotalaria tetragona Andrews is a tall rattlepod widely distributed across tropical and subtropical Asia, native from India, Nepal, Bhutan and Bangladesh through southern China, Myanmar, Thailand, Laos, Vietnam, Cambodia and the Malesian region; GBIF lists about 405 occurrences, with records from Brazil, Jamaica, Colombia and Mauritius indicating introduction and naturalisation. It grows in open grassland, forest margins, scrub and disturbed roadside ground in the warm subtropical and submontane zone, generally below about 2000 m. The photographed plant from Trashiyangtse in eastern Bhutan at around 1780 m, flowering in October, reflects its occurrence in warm, lower-elevation valley habitats.

The species is a robust erect perennial herb or subshrub with conspicuously four-angled, often winged stems, the epithet tetragona alluding to this quadrangular form. The leaves are simple, elliptic to lanceolate and entire. The flowers are borne in long terminal racemes and are large and bright yellow, with the standard frequently veined reddish-brown; the calyx is deeply lobed and the keel beaked in the papilionaceous arrangement. The fruit is a large, inflated, oblong pod that turns blackish and rattles when the loose seeds detach at maturity, giving the genus its common name.

Crotalaria (Fabaceae, subfamily Faboideae, tribe Crotalarieae) is a large pantropical genus of nitrogen-fixing legumes, several used as green manure and fibre plants. C. tetragona is locally common and weedy, of least conservation concern, and like its congeners may contain pyrrolizidine alkaloids rendering it toxic to livestock.

Crucihimalaya himalaica is a widespread alpine crucifer of the High Asian mountains, strongly represented in GBIF with about 704 occurrences spanning India, China, Nepal, Pakistan, Bhutan, Afghanistan, Iran and Myanmar. It is a plant of open, often disturbed high-elevation ground, growing on stony slopes, screes, moraine, grazed turf, fallow and the margins of cultivation in the subalpine and alpine belts. The plants photographed at Phajoding in Bhutan at about 3700 m and south of Rara Lake in West Nepal at 3400 m, both in June, illustrate its characteristic occupation of open alpine slopes early in the growing season across the breadth of the range.

It is an annual to short-lived perennial herb with a basal rosette of oblanceolate to spathulate leaves bearing toothed or lyrate-pinnatifid margins, the herbage often clothed in branched (stellate or dendritic) and simple hairs. The erect, sparingly leafy stems terminate in racemes of small flowers with four free sepals and four white to pale lilac petals arranged in the cruciform pattern of the family, and six stamens in the usual tetradynamous arrangement. The fruit is a slender, linear, elongate silique that ascends to spreading and dehisces by two valves from a persistent septum to release the seeds.

The genus Crucihimalaya was segregated from Arabis and allied genera on molecular and morphological grounds by Al-Shehbaz, O'Kane and R.A.Price, and it is closely related to Arabidopsis, making the group of interest in comparative and evolutionary genomics. As an abundant, ecologically flexible species thriving in both natural and anthropogenically disturbed alpine habitats, C. himalaica is of no conservation concern, and its wide range reflects effective dispersal and tolerance of harsh, open mountain conditions.

Cupressus torulosa D.Don, the Himalayan or Bhutan cypress, is a coniferous evergreen tree of the Cupressaceae native to the Himalaya and southwestern China. Its native range covers India, Nepal and China, while the large GBIF tally of 1,094 occurrences and many additional countries (New Zealand, USA, Britain, Germany, Australia, South Africa, Brazil and others) reflects its extensive cultivation as an ornamental and forestry tree. In the wild it grows on dry, calcareous and rocky slopes in temperate forests, typically between 1,800 and 3,300 m. The photographed tree from the Pugmo-Khola in West Nepal at 3,400 m, in July, marks the upper edge of its altitudinal distribution.

The plant is a tall, conical to broadly columnar tree reaching 20–45 m, with reddish-brown, fibrous, vertically peeling bark and spreading branches bearing slender, pendulous, terete branchlets. The leaves are scale-like, decussate, closely appressed, dark green and obtuse, lacking a conspicuous dorsal gland. It is monoecious, the small ovoid male cones terminal on lateral branchlets and the female cones globose, 1–2 cm across, composed of 8–12 woody peltate scales each bearing a small umbo and ripening from glaucous green to grey-brown in the second year, releasing numerous narrowly winged seeds.

The taxonomy of Asian Cupressus has been much debated, with several Himalayan and Chinese populations variously segregated or lumped, but C. torulosa is consistently accepted as the core western Himalayan species. Long valued for its durable, aromatic timber and planted around temples and monasteries, it is locally over-exploited; while not globally threatened, several native stands are fragmented, and it remains an important component of dry temperate conifer woodland.

Curculigo gracilis Kurz (accepted by some authorities as Molineria gracilis, under which name the species page is filed) is a small rhizomatous herb of the Hypoxidaceae distributed through the eastern Himalaya and into Southeast Asia. GBIF records, numbering 70 occurrences, span China, Thailand, India, Nepal, Bhutan, Cambodia and Vietnam. The species grows in the shaded, humid understorey of subtropical and lower montane broadleaved forests, on moist, humus-rich banks and slopes, generally between roughly 700 and 1,800 m. The illustrated plant from Godavari near Kathmandu in Nepal at 1,400 m, in May, is typical of this damp mid-hill forest habitat.

The plant arises from a short, tuberous, vertical rhizome and produces a small tuft of basal leaves. The leaves are linear-lanceolate to narrowly elliptic, plicate (longitudinally pleated) and conspicuously veined, tapering to a slender petiole-like base and often thinly hairy. The flowers are borne on short, often subterranean to ground-level scapes hidden among the leaf bases; each flower is small, bright yellow, with six spreading tepals, and the ovary is inferior and frequently prolonged into a slender beak, a diagnostic feature of the genus. The fruit is a small, fleshy, indehiscent berry-like capsule containing black, often beaked seeds.

The generic limits of Curculigo and the segregate Molineria have long been disputed, and this species is treated under both names depending on the classification followed; the disposition adopted here follows the source page in recognising Molineria gracilis as the accepted combination. As a forest-floor geophyte of humid Asian woodlands, it is of no particular conservation concern across its range, but it contributes to the diversity of the shaded understorey and is part of a genus of modest economic and ethnobotanical interest in tropical Asia.

Curcuma aromatica, wild or yellow zedoary, is a South and Southeast Asian rhizomatous herb with a broad distribution documented by 490 GBIF occurrences across China (CN), India (IN), Hong Kong (HK), Bhutan (BT), Sri Lanka (LK), Myanmar (MM), Thailand (TH), Nepal (NP), Vietnam (VN), Bangladesh (BD), Laos (LA), Pakistan (PK), Indonesia (ID), Korea (KR), Malaysia (MY) and Taiwan (TW), with cultivated records in Japan (JP), Colombia (CO) and Britain (GB). It grows in moist deciduous and semi-evergreen forest, scrub and forest margins, often near habitation as a semi-cultivated medicinal plant. The illustrated collections span Bhutan at Trithangebe near a farmhouse at 800 m in May and the Nepalese sites of Banyang at 2100 m in March and Korong in East-Nepal at 1150 m in April.

It is a stout perennial arising from a fleshy, aromatic, internally orange-yellow rhizome bearing sessile and stalked tubers. The pseudostem supports large oblong to oblong-lanceolate leaves, pubescent beneath. The inflorescence appears before or with the leaves as a lateral spike, its lower fertile bracts green and the upper sterile coma bracts tinged pink to rose; the flowers are pale yellow with a tubular calyx, a hooded dorsal corolla lobe and a deflexed, emarginate yellow labellum. Fruit is a capsule, though spread is mainly clonal.

Widely employed in traditional medicine and as a cosmetic and culinary turmeric substitute, C. aromatica is rich in aromatic essential oils and curcuminoids. Curcuma zedoaria, white turmeric or zedoary, is a tropical and subtropical species of probable northeast Indian and Southeast Asian origin that is now pantropically cultivated and naturalised. Its 694 GBIF occurrences span an extensive range including India (IN), China (CN), Thailand (TH), the Philippines (PH), Taiwan (TW), Indonesia (ID), Bangladesh (BD), Vietnam (VN), Malaysia (MY), Myanmar (MM), Sri Lanka (LK) and Japan (JP), alongside introductions to the Neotropics in Costa Rica (CR), Brazil (BR), Colombia (CO), French Guiana (GF), Panama (PA) and Ecuador (EC), and the United States (US). It thrives in warm, humid lowland and lower-montane situations, in moist forest understorey, clearings and as a cultivated medicinal and ornamental rhizomatous herb.

It is a robust herbaceous perennial arising from a large, fleshy, aromatic, yellowish-internally rhizome with cylindrical tuberous roots. The pseudostem is formed by the sheathing leaf bases, bearing oblong-lanceolate leaves that often display a characteristic reddish-purple midrib stripe. The inflorescence emerges separately from the rhizome, a spike of imbricate green and pink coma bracts subtending small pale-yellow flowers; each flower has a tubular calyx, a corolla with a hooded dorsal lobe, and a showy three-lobed labellum derived from staminodes. The fruit is a trilocular capsule, though propagation is chiefly vegetative.

Long used in traditional Asian medicine for its bitter, camphoraceous rhizome, zedoary is valued as a digestive and source of essential oils. Its taxonomy within the variable genus Curcuma has been complicated by sterile triploid cultivated clones and by confusion with allies such as C. aromatica and C. caesia.
